Virax Biolabs to raise $3.3M via preferred option exercise

July 9, 2026 1:36 PM EDT

Virax Biolabs Group Limited (Nasdaq: VRAX) has entered into a definitive agreement for the exercise of certain outstanding preferred investment options, expecting to generate approximately $3.3 million in gross proceeds before placement agent fees and offering expenses.

The agreement covers the exercise of options to purchase up to 548,000 ordinary shares at a reduced price of $6.00 per share, down from an original exercise price of $10.00. The options were originally issued in October 2023, amended in December 2025, and in December 2025.

In exchange for the immediate cash exercise, the company will issue two new series of unregistered warrants. The Series A Preferred Investment Options cover up to 548,000 ordinary shares, and the Series B Preferred Investment Options cover up to 1,096,000 ordinary shares. Both carry an exercise price of $6.00 per share and become exercisable following shareholder approval of an increase in the company's authorized ordinary shares.

The Series A options expire five years after the later of the effective date of a resale registration statement or the authorized share increase. The Series B options carry an 18-month expiration under the same conditions.

The offering was expected to close on or about July 10, 2026, subject to customary closing conditions. The company said it intends to use net proceeds for working capital and general corporate purposes.

H.C. Wainwright & Co. is acting as exclusive placement agent for the offering. The company said it has agreed to file a registration statement with the Securities and Exchange Commission covering the resale of shares issuable upon exercise of the new warrants.
